Amherst 35, Bonduel 7

Four turnovers hurt Bonduel in a Central Wisconsin Conference-Large Division home loss to Amherst on Friday. Bonduel slipped to 4-2 overall and 2-2 in conference play.

The Bears turned the ball over three times in the first half, allowing Amherst to take a 28-0 lead into halftime.

Bonduel kept fighting in the second half, and eventually found the end zone in the fourth quarter on a 10-yard touchdown pass from Cole Letter to Dylan Burch. An interception by Bonduel’s Logan Majewski set up the scoring drive.

Witt-Birn 27, Shiocton 9

Wittenberg-Birnamwood knocked off Shiocton in Wittenberg on Friday.

The Chargers improved to 5-1 on the season and 2-1 in conference play.

Clintonville 17, Green Bay East 14

Tucker Pari hit a 21-yard field goal in the final minute of play to lift Clintonville to a nonconference win over Green Bay East on Friday in Green Bay.

Brock Smejkal caught two touchdown passes for Clintonville, which outgained Green Bay East 322-108 and is now 1-5 overall. Smejkal finished with four receptions and 103 receiving yards

Smejkal caught the first touchdown on a pass from Dylan Arnold, while Braiden Behnke threw Smejkal the game-tying score. Arnold finished with 53 rushing yards and 91 passing yards, while Behnke had 101 passing yards.

Ryan Wegenke rushed for 68 yards for the Truckers. Dylan Danforth caught three passes for 65 yards.

Marion/Tigerton 28, Tri-County 14

Marion/Tigerton doubled up Tri-County behind strong games from Ethan Scheef and Austin Hoffmann. The co-op is 3-3 overall for the season.

Scheef had a hand in all four Marion/Tigerton touchdowns. He rushed for 175 yards and two scores, while throwing for 98 yards and two scores. Hoffmann caught two passes and turned both receptions into touchdowns.

Cayden Schoen hauled in a 42-yard pass for the Thundercatz.

Xavier 49, Shawano 23

Shawano dropped a Bay Conference road game to Xavier on Friday. The loss leaves Shawano with a 3-3 record overall and in the Bay.

Xavier scored 42 unanswered points after Shawano tied the game at seven in the second quarter.

Shawano’s Elliott Lowney hauled in six receptions for 100 yards and a pair of touchdowns. Nick Sherman had two catches for 71 yards.

Brayden Dickelman rushed for 138 yards and the Hawks’ other touchdown. Gage Timm finished with 167 passing yards and two touchdowns while also rushing for 38 yards.

Port Edwards 53, Bowler/Gresham 0

Bowler/Gresham lost a road contest to Port Edwards on Friday. Bowler/Gresham fell to 0-3 on the season.

Port Edwards rushed for 350 yards in the contest.

Bowler/Gresham's Daquan Malone-Gregory caught a game-high eight passes, while Logan Thiex had seven. On defense, Zach Ziemer led the co-op with seven solo tackles.

Deerfield 34, Menominee Indian 14

Menominee Indian was unable to keep pace with Deerfield in a nonconference matchup in Keshena on Saturday.

Menominee Indian is now 2-4 on the season.
